This section of the manual describes how to connect the IntraPort 2/2+ VPN Access Server to your Ethernet network. In summary, the steps for installation are:

1.Make sure the server is powered down and not connected to any power source.

2.Connect the server to the Ethernet network(s).

3.Connect a management console to the server (optional).

4.Plug in the power cable and power up the server.

Placing the Server

The IntraPort 2/2+ VPN Access Servers are meant to be left stand-alone on a desktop or equipment table.

ϖNote: When stacking other equipment on the IntraPort 2/2+, do not exceed 25 pounds of evenly distributed weight on top of the device. Additional weight may bend the case.

Connecting the Server to the Ethernet

Because Ethernet 1 is IPSec-only (meaning it will only handle IPSec packets and will drop all other traffic), you need to pay special attention to your Ethernet connection setup.

Ethernet 1 should only be used if you are planning to set the IntraPort 2/2+ to operate in parallel with your existing firewall. This is the recom- mended setup. In this scenario, Ethernet 1 should be connected to the same Ethernet segment as your Internet gateway router while Ethernet 0 will serve as an IP, IPX and AppleTalk router port for your internal networks.
